Significance of Child Teeth Treatment



You must focus on brushing and flossing to preserve the total health of your kid's primary teeth. Baby teeth play a crucial role in your youngster's dental development. They help your kid chew, talk, and smile appropriately.



Ignoring the care of baby teeth can lead to various dental health and wellness concerns, such as dental cavity and gum illness. Cleaning two times a day with a fluoride tooth paste assists eliminate plaque and bacteria that can trigger dental caries. Flossing daily is similarly essential to clean the areas between the teeth that a tooth brush can't get to.

Establishing a Dental Routine for Your Kid



It is essential to create a regular dental regimen for your youngster, making sure that they brush and floss their teeth regularly. By developing great dental hygiene routines at a young age, you're establishing your child up for a lifetime of healthy and balanced teeth and periodontals.

Right here are 3 essential actions to assist you develop a dental routine for your child:

2. Introduce cleaning: When your kid's very first tooth appears, begin using a small, soft-bristled toothbrush and a rice-sized quantity of fluoride toothpaste. Brush their teeth two times a day, ensuring to get to all surface areas.

3. Motivate flossing: When your child's teeth start touching, usually around the age of 2 or 3, present flossing. Use child-friendly flossers or floss choices to make it easier for them.

Tips for Stopping Dental Caries in Child Pearly Whites



To prevent tooth decay in your youngster's baby teeth, follow these basic pointers.

- First, see to it to clean your kid's teeth twice a day making use of a soft-bristled tooth brush and a pea-sized amount of fluoride toothpaste. Encourage them to spit out the toothpaste rather than swallowing it.

- Limitation sweet beverages and treats, as they can contribute to dental caries. Rather, provide healthy and balanced snacks like vegetables and fruits.
